A snippet of Adam Lambert's new track "Time for Miracles" has been debuted. On Friday, October 9, AOL has released a 86-second video, which offers a cut from the chorus of the soundtrack to upcoming movie "2012 (2009)" as well as some scenes from the Roland Emmerich-directed film.
At the beginning of the clip, Adam is seen talking about the song. "We wanted to match how epic the film is. We want the song to really reach out and grab people by the heart. So, it's definitely the focus [the song]," he states. Few lines of the lyrics mention, "Baby you know that maybe it's time for miracles. 'Cause I ain't givin' up on love. You know that maybe it's time for miracles..."
"Time for Miracles" will not be the lead single off Adam's upcoming not-yet-titled post-Idol album. Meanwhile, the "2012 (2009)" soundtrack album will be released in the U.S. on October 25, two weeks before the world premiere of the film on November 11. Recently, the runner-up of "American Idol" season 8 has shot the music video for the song.
